Boys and Girls basketball starting off strong

Two weeks into the 2013-2014 basketball season,the Eagles are off to a 5-0 start. For girls action, the Lady Eagles are off to a 3-2 start.

On December 3, the Eagles and the Lady Eagles tipped off against Livingston Central for the first game of the season. Both teams came out victorious with huge win. The boys flew away with a 66-27 win. The Lady Eagles dominated the Lady Cardinals, winning by a margin of 30 points, 64-34.

Over the weekend of December 5, the boys played in the annual Marshall County Hoopfest. Taking on Massac County, the Eagles came out with a 75-65 win. During the snow break, Fulton County traveled to the Eagles Nest to walk away defeated. The Eagles crushed the Pilots 76-43.

After a week off of school, Graves County traveled to Calloway to play a double header. The Lady Eagles put up a fight but game out on the short hand of the stick. They were defeated 65-51 by the Lady Lakers. After beating Calloway in the regional tournament last season, the Eagles weren’t going to let the Lakers run away with an easy win. Coming out on top, the Eagles won 57-42.

On December 14 the Lady Eagles were set to play Webster County at the Eagles Nest. After winning by a margin of 13, 81-68, the Lady Eagles moved to 2-1.

For the first district game of the year, Graves traveled to the corn fields of Ballard County to take on the Bombers Monday night. Both teams came out victorious. The Eagles won by a huge 32 points, 81-49 moving to 1-0 in District Three play. The Lady Eagles also won 73-57 moving to 1-0 in district play.

Thursday night the Lady Eagles received their second loss of the 2013-2014 season. Loading up the bus, the girls headed to Calloway County for the Heritage Bank Hardwood Classic. After taking on a team from Westview, Tennessee the ladies put up a fight but lost, 46-42.

The Lady Eagles play tonight against a team from Frederick Douglass, Tennessee in the Heritage Bank Hardwood Classic. In the Eagle Holiday Classic, the Eagles play West Creek, Tennessee tonight at the Eagles Nest.
